9.. HOW DID YOU FIRST DISCOVER CAPTAIN BEEFHEART & THE MAGIC BAND,
AND WAS THERE A PARTICULAR SONG THAT MADE YOU SEE THE LIGHT?:
I first heard "Diddy Wah Diddy" on AM radio in 1966 when I was 11...loved
it immediately, there was nothing even remotely like it on the Top 40 airwaves
in those days. I managed to find a copy of the single and played it until
it wore out. However, I didn't hear any more about Beefheart until 1969,
when I picked up a copy of "Trout Mask Replica" at my local record store.
Beefheart promptly joined my Top Three list of favorite musicians -- along
with Frank Zappa and the Bonzo Dog Band.

12. ANY CONTACT WITH DON?:
Yes. I met Don in 1970 and saw him on an irregular basis from then
until late 1975. Last contact was in 1980.
Have Magic Marker drawing he did of me in 1970 -- unfortunately I don't
have a scan readily available ( but it is reproduced in "Being Frank").
In 1980 I wrote an article about Don, "Trout Mask Rendezvous," which was
published in the Los Angeles Reader.
